“More finesse-oriented than the blockbuster style La Colline release, the 2015 Gigondas le Lieu Dit is another Grenache-dominated wine that comes from a cooler, late parcel of sandy soils located just beside the estate. Notes of strawberries, raspberries, crushed flowers, kirsch and spice all emerge from this full-bodied, utterly seamless, pure and gorgeously balanced beauty that doesn’t have a hard edge to be found. It will drink well for 10-15 years or more.”

95-97 Points, Jeb Dunnuck, The Wine Advocate

“Intense raspberry and boysenberry fruit unwinds slowly here, with light bergamot, black tea and violet notes skittering throughout. The structure is ample but very fine-grained, and there’s lilting perfume lingering on the mineral-edged finish. Best from 2019 through 2030.”

95 Points, Wine Spectator

Product Description

Domaine des Bosquets has deep historical roots in Gigondas. It was first mentioned as a vineyard site in 1376. Bosquets means “a wooded grove,” which is an apt name since many of the vineyards high up in the Dentelles are isolated and surrounded by forest.

Le Lieu Dit is a parcel of old-vine Grenache planted on sand with north and northwestern exposure. At 210 meters in elevation this site is late-ripening and low-yielding, averaging only 16hl/ha. It is fermented with 30% whole clusters and by natural yeasts and is aged in only neutral 600L French oak demi-muids.
